Practice ID |
The Practice ID is a mandatory requirement to confirm the details are being updated on the correct profile. If the practice ID is missing, invalid or incorrect and no more than 1 other piece of information is missing, the practice ID can be obtained verbally. Staff must:

The practice must provide the practice address. Check if the practice address on the practice profile matches the details on the form. An address variance may be accepted. If the address does not match, check the Locations screen to see if the address matches a registered additional branch location.
